What Soft Skills are Important in a Call Center?

Fonolo

Call center agents do much more than answer the phone. To achieve their performance goals , agents must be excellent problem solvers, expert rapport builders, and highly empathetic to the challenges of their customers. That’s why soft skills are so important in this line of work. To keep your customers happy, your contact center needs to know what types of transferable skills to look for in new hires, while also supporting the development of these same skills in your existing team members.

4 ways social listening reports unlock the business value of customer experience

Sprinklr

Digital and social platforms have transformed the way consumers interact with your brand and communicate their experiences and expectations. Customers may not always mention you by name, but they are constantly sharing feedback on dozens of social media and messaging channels. Social listening helps you reach across this feedback ecosystem for insights into customer experience (CX) and new opportunities for business value.

6 Tips to Improve Your Contact Center’s Net Promoter Score

Fonolo

The reviews for your contact center are in—but they won’t be found in the newspaper or on Rotten Tomatoes. You can see what your customers think about your contact center by determining your Net Promoter Score (NPS). Customer experience surveys can tell you a lot about the service callers are receiving from agents, and NPS is a key statistic you should be considering when reviewing how successful your contact center is at providing exceptional customer service.
